Toby Keith has sold more than 30 million albums and charted over 60 singles, creating a country music career for himself that many artists only dream about. Although Keith counts himself as fortunate in that regard, he admits that his fame comes with a price.

"I’m so blessed that I get to do what I want to do. The artist in me gets to cut the songwriter in me['s] songs, and vice versa. I’ve always been comfortable just doing what I do and not having the accolades. And there may be a little bit [because] that’s a two-sided sword," Keith explained during his talk at the 2017 Country Radio Seminar. "The biggest fear you can have in this business is failure. But I’ve also got a little bit of a fear about being too successful, being too famous.

"I would like going out and being myself. It’s difficult, but if I can find places that are sanctuaries to me, I love to just go and be me," he adds. "I have people all the time go, ‘I can’t believe how freaking normal you are.’ I’m like, ‘There are enough a--holes in the world.’"

Still, Keith understands that, more often than not, when he leaves his house, he's going to get attention, both from fans and paparazzi. That's why he finally made peace with being a public figure.

"I tell my family, it’s a lot easier to just take the picture and let them go on than explain why we can’t," Keith explains. "It takes a long time to explain to someone why they got a picture and you didn’t, so just snap it and go on. Most of the time, people get it out of the way and go …

"It’s part of the business," Keith continues. "If you just want to be a hermit and not get out, then live like that. I don’t want to be with that. I just lead with my face and figure it out later."
